A tidy semi‑detached bungalow set at the end of a quiet cul‑de‑sac, this freehold two‑bedroom home has easy, single‑level living plus two usable attic rooms for hobbies or occasional guests. The property sits on a decent plot with lawned front and rear gardens and a wide driveway that will accommodate up to three cars — a rare plus for village‑edge retirement living.
Internally the layout is practical: lounge, kitchen, bathroom and two ground‑floor bedrooms, with two first‑floor attic rooms accessed via a staircase from the dining/bedroom. The kitchen is a functional 1990s fit with laminated worktops and integrated oven; the bathroom is fully tiled. Gas central heating and uPVC double glazing are fitted throughout.
Notable positives include the off‑street parking, manageable garden, low local crime and good broadband and mobile signal — useful if you plan to work from home or keep in touch with family. Council Tax Band C and freehold tenure keep ongoing costs straightforward.
Buyers should note the property’s age (mid‑20th century) and construction — cavity walls are assumed to lack modern insulation — so there’s scope to improve energy efficiency. The attic rooms are irregularly shaped and relatively small, so headroom and full‑time use may be limited. Boundaries and title details have not been checked and should be confirmed prior to exchange. Overall, this bungalow will suit downsizers or retirees seeking a low‑maintenance home with modest improvement potential.
